Getting There
-
Driving
If driving from Tbilisi, take the highway towards Tetritskaro. Once in Tetritskaro, follow local signs towards Kiketi and then to Kabeni Monastery. The monastery is located near the village of Kiketi in the Asuretistskali Gorge. Be aware that some roads may be unpaved or have limited signage in English. Parking is available near the monastery. There are no tolls on this route.
-
Public Transport
To reach Kabeni Monastery via public transport, take a marshrutka (minibus) from Tbilisi to Tetritskaro. From Tetritskaro, you may need to take a local taxi or walk to Kiketi and then to the monastery, as direct transport to Kabeni is limited. The marshrutka from Tbilisi to Tetritskaro costs approximately 5-10 GEL. A taxi from Tetritskaro to Kabeni Monastery may cost an additional 15-20 GEL. Remember to confirm the price with the driver before starting your journey.
